Well I decided to grab the new N450 and the new 465 from DTR to see what they could do?:thinking: So I also grabbed two sxd drivers. One set at 4.0 amps for the n465 and 4.5 amps set for the n450. ( knew I was pushing the the n450 pretty hard, but I'm a glutton for punishment) Choose to put them in the Lux-pro 600 host.

1), First we lined up all the parts
2), Than unwrapped Lifetimes polished heat sinks and separated the drivers.
3), Wired up the drivers.
4), Dismantled the pill that came with the host.
5), Than removed all the components on the driver board.( wont be needing them). Than drilled a hole in the board for the positive lead.
6), Next thermo epoxied the sxd drivers in the pill, let dry for an hour. Grabbed a bite to eat.
7), Trimmed all the wires and soldered the positive wire in the center of the driver boards and soldered and pinched the ground wire in between the driver board and the pill. Used a small vice to squeeze the ground wire in nice and snug.
8), Soldered up the diodes to there matching drivers and shrink tubed the solder joints.
9), Lined up all the parts for the final assembly.
10), Made final assembly, put batteries in.

Very nice builds. Are you sure it is the diode and not the driver or power source. Both can leave the unit looking similar just emitting faint light but one way to tell without taking it apart is to see is the module making a lot of heat or not. If it is not making a lot of heat it might just be the driver or power source as if it is getting 4.5A there will be lot energy being dumped as heat but if it is not getting much power either from a damaged SXD or say batteries where one has tripped the protection PCB.

While 4.5A is higher than I recommend I don't think it would pop it off the bat based on what I have seen of them.

That is a bummer.

Yea for troubleshooting I would put the the driver on a test load with it still bonded in the pill, pill screwed into the host and powered by the batteries to see if it is working correctly in is final operating environment. One thought I have is if there is a short of the driver to the pill when powered in the host by batteries it could bypass the driver and give a straight shot to the diode. This might now show up if you test the driver with a PSU outside the host not sharing a common ground.
